TV-Magazine (テレビマガジン Terebi Magazin or "Televi-Magazine") and TV-Boy (てれびくん Terebikun "Televi-Kun", note the different kana used) are the two main boys' magazines that Transformers appear in. Being boys' magazines, they're filled contemporary TV series and movies for younger boys, including Super Sentai, Kamen Rider and others.

Previously, TakaraTomy has offered the Temenos Sword and the Gold Vector Shield. Now, we have news of some new promotions!

Starting September 16th, any shopper that buys more than 2000 Yen (about $18-$19 USD) worth of Last Knight toys in participating Japanese stores will get a DVD containing the stop-motion sequences and transformation videos TakaraTomy has created to promote the movie line.

Come the month after, and we're back to vacuum-metalized accessory giveaways. In October, another 2000+ Yen purchase will get you the Bronze Calibur Axe, a presumably bronze version of the axe included with the TakaraTomy Calibur Optimus Prime, which is based on the axe that Prime wielded in the Dark of the Moon film. In November, spend another 2000+ Yen and you get two weapons: Optimus' Gold Temenos Sword and Megatron's Gold Battle Axe. Apparently Megatron prefers more blunt (and somewhat inaccurate) names for his weapons.

It was announced on 7net.omni that Takara Tomy has made available this special Clear Voyager The Last Knight Optimus Prime. We have posted the images below so that you can have a look at this super cool figure. This offer is only available to those in Japan starting 12/13/17 who purchase any of the following:

    Blu-Ray + DVD + Special Features Blu-Ray.
    3D + Blu-Ray + Special Features Blu-Ray.
    4K + + Blu-Ray + Special Features Blu-Ray.
    5 Movie Collection either Blu-Ray or DVD versions.

We have a pair of updates for you today regarding some Takara Exclusive gold weapons.

The first update comes concerning the Bronze Caliber Axe, the gold colored version of the axe that comes with Caliber Optimus Prime that was revealed over here. The axe is now available, and here is how you get it: go to Takara Tomy Mall, spend at least 2000 yen, and a Caliber Axe is yours! This information, along with an image of the bronze axe, comes from Snakas Blog.

The second update, also from Snakas blog, reveals that starting November 11, a second promotion will be happening where you can spend 5000 yen at Takara Tomy Mall and a gold version of Megatron's battle axe and Optimus' Temenos sword can be yours! The pair were teased in the previous story that you can see above, but here are finally shown in full.
